Smith & Wesson Performance Center Model 629-6 Comp Hunter .44 Magnum Revolver – Ported 7.5" Stainless, Early-Run Discontinued Variant
This Performance Center Model 629-6 Comp Hunter is an early-2000s, factory-tuned .44 Magnum built for precise field and silhouette work. A 7.5-inch, full-lug stainless barrel with a two-port compensator and drilled-and-tapped rib sets it apart from standard 629s, while chamfered charge holes, a ball-detent yoke lock-up, and chrome-flashed action parts showcase Performance Center craftsmanship. Discontinued after a short run, Comp Hunter revolvers are increasingly scarce, making this example noteworthy for shooters and collectors alike.
The satin stainless finish, factory-smoothed trigger, and teardrop hammer give the gun a refined feel. Adjustable sights with a pinned orange ramp front and white-outline rear provide a clear sight picture, and an included optic rail lets the user add glass without gunsmithing. Performance Center fit and finish start with the 7.5-inch stainless barrel, which wears an integral two-port compensator to tame .44 Magnum recoil and muzzle rise. The full-lug profile adds forward weight for smoother follow-up shots, and the drilled-and-tapped rib accepts the included optic rail for quick scope or red-dot installation.
The N-frame revolver employs a ball-detent yoke lock-up and chamfered charge holes for fast, positive cylinder alignment and speed-loader use. Inside, a chrome-flashed teardrop hammer and .312-inch smooth trigger are factory-tuned and fitted with an over-travel stop, delivering a clean break in single-action and a consistent double-action pull.
Durable satin stainless steel is used for the frame, barrel, and unfluted cylinder, providing corrosion resistance and a unified appearance. A Hogue rubber Monogrip comes installed for recoil control, while spare laminated grips let the owner tailor feel and aesthetics.
Factory adjustable iron sights combine a pinned orange ramp front with a white-outline micrometer rear, giving a crisp sight picture in varying light. For added security, the revolver includes S&W’s internal key-lock safety, discreetly housed above the cylinder release.
